Mercurial > hg > nginx-quic
comparison src/event/ngx_event_quic_transport.h @ 7917:90b02ff6b003 quic
Compatibility with BoringSSL master branch.
Recently BoringSSL introduced SSL_set_quic_early_data_context()
that serves as an additional constrain to enable 0-RTT in QUIC.
Relevant changes:
* https://boringssl.googlesource.com/boringssl/+/7c52299%5E!/
* https://boringssl.googlesource.com/boringssl/+/8519432%5E!/
author | Sergey Kandaurov <pluknet@nginx.com> |
---|---|
date | Mon, 01 Jun 2020 19:53:13 +0300 |
parents | 6633f17044eb |
children | 6ea2f1daedb5 |
comparison
equal
deleted
inserted
replaced
7916:c206233d9c29 | 7917:90b02ff6b003 |
---|---|
333 u_char *end, uint64_t *gap, uint64_t *range); | 333 u_char *end, uint64_t *gap, uint64_t *range); |
334 | 334 |
335 ngx_int_t ngx_quic_parse_transport_params(u_char *p, u_char *end, | 335 ngx_int_t ngx_quic_parse_transport_params(u_char *p, u_char *end, |
336 ngx_quic_tp_t *tp, ngx_log_t *log); | 336 ngx_quic_tp_t *tp, ngx_log_t *log); |
337 ssize_t ngx_quic_create_transport_params(u_char *p, u_char *end, | 337 ssize_t ngx_quic_create_transport_params(u_char *p, u_char *end, |
338 ngx_quic_tp_t *tp); | 338 ngx_quic_tp_t *tp, size_t *clen); |
339 | 339 |
340 #endif /* _NGX_EVENT_QUIC_WIRE_H_INCLUDED_ */ | 340 #endif /* _NGX_EVENT_QUIC_WIRE_H_INCLUDED_ */ |